dc.description.abstractThe growing number of medical digital images necessitates their secure sharing among specialists and hospitals while protecting patient privacy. To achieve this, medical image watermarking is essential. However, the watermarking process must be carefully executed for two key reasons. Firstly, it should not compromise image quality. Secondly, confidential patient information embedded in the image should be reliably retrievable even after decompression. Despite extensive research in this area, no existing method fulfills all requirements of medical image watermarking. This study aims to address this gap by providing a comprehensive survey of different methods, including DWT with SVD and spread spectrum, analyzing their strengths and weaknesses, and offering valuable insights to researchers.en_US
